Specs:
  • Base Clock Up to: 1700 MHz
  • Game Clock Up To: 1815 MHz
  • Boost Clock Up to: 2105 MHz
  • Stream Processors: 3840
  • Compute Units: 60
  • Memory Bus: 256 bit
  • Dimensions: 340x130x52mm
  • Outputs: 3x DisplayPort 1.4, 2x HDMI 2.1
  • Requires 2x 8-Pin PCIe Power Connectors
